Cultural Jigsaw: Become an Expert!
All students will be divided into five equal groups - "Expert Groups". Once assigned a group, join your group and work together on a specific topic assigned to your group. Once each group finishes working on their specific topics, the groups will be reorganized into new groups. There will be only ONE Expert on a particular topic in each group. Each expert will teach the rest of the group his/her topic. By the end of the activity, all groups and group members will be competent in all topics.
|
Find your Expert Group and discuss the following:
- Provide a brief characteristic of the concept. What key words can you use to describe it to someone not familiar with this topic?
- In what way does it affect culture?
- Provide two examples of your particular cultural concept in a "real life"
- Provide two reasons why it is important to know about these concepts?
